How to design a partner enablement content update cadence that ensures resellers receive the latest product, pricing, and pitch materials for SaaS.

An effective partner enablement cadence starts with a clear governance model. Define who owns content creation, review, and deployment, and set decision rights for product launches, pricing changes, and sales messaging. Map these responsibilities to quarterly product roadmaps and monthly pricing cycles so updates align with real-world changes. Establish a shared calendar that tracks feed intervals, content owners, and target reseller segments. Invest in a lightweight content management process that prioritizes accuracy over volume, enabling rapid iteration without sacrificing quality. By starting with structure, you create a reliable rhythm that reduces last-minute tweaks and delivers consistent, trusted material to every reseller.
In practice, the cadence should balance immediacy with stability. For SaaS, product updates often trigger pricing adjustments and new pitch angles; the cadence must reflect these events without overwhelming partners. Implement a tiered update model: critical updates happen as soon as they’re approved, frequent but minor changes occur on a biweekly basis, and strategic narratives roll out quarterly. Each update should come with a concise summary, the rationale, and a best-practice playbook showing how to present the changes to customers. Pair this with a centralized repository so resellers can access the latest assets at any time, with historical versions preserved for reference.
Timely, clear updates empower sales teams to win more often.
Consistency is the backbone of partner enablement. Resellers rely on a dependable stream of information to maintain credibility with customers. A predictable cadence reduces uncertainty, enabling regional teams to plan outreach, tailor messages, and forecast opportunities more accurately. Build a feedback loop where frontline sellers report which updates landed well and which fell flat. Use that input to refine future materials, trimming jargon, aligning pricing narratives with real discounts, and clarifying competitive positioning. When updates arrive on a regular schedule, partners feel supported rather than surprised, and educators in the field can weave content into ongoing training and coaching programs.

To operationalize consistency, create a standard template for every update: executive summary, change log, impact analysis, recommended talking points, and a 60-second pitch script. Include visuals such as updated product screenshots, pricing tables, and use-case one-pagers. Ensure translations or local adaptations are planned in advance for regions with multilingual reseller networks. Assign time-bound review checkpoints to guarantee accuracy before publication, and publish updates through a single channel with clear notification rules. Finally, implement a simple success metric set, including adoption rate, time-to-inform, and win-rate changes, to gauge the cadence’s effectiveness over time.

A well-managed inventory supports scalable, precise localization.
The cadence design must embed a strong content inventory strategy. Catalog every asset—product sheets, pricing grids, battle cards, and objection-handling guides—by product, market segment, and activation stage. Regularly prune outdated materials and retire assets that no longer reflect reality, while tagging evergreen resources that underpin long-term sales motions. Automate checks that flag conflicting messages across channels and designate a steward who ensures consistency from product marketing to field operations. A living inventory reduces duplication, accelerates rollout, and helps managers answer questions like “What’s new this quarter?” with confidence rather than guesswork.

Complement the inventory with a robust localization plan. For global partner networks, ensure materials accommodate local currencies, regulatory considerations, and language nuances. Create region-specific launch playbooks that translate core messaging into culturally resonant narratives while preserving the integrity of the overall value proposition. Establish a continuous improvement loop that captures regional feedback on messaging effectiveness and pricing sensitivity, feeding that input back into content ideation and iteration. This approach keeps the global partner ecosystem cohesive while honoring regional realities, ultimately driving faster adoption and higher partner satisfaction.
Training that translates updates into real customer outcomes.
Training and enablement must accompany every update. Resellers need more than assets; they require guided practice to deploy them confidently. Develop micro-learning modules that explain the rationale behind each change, followed by role-playing scenarios and customer-ready scripts. Schedule spotlight sessions with product managers to discuss upcoming changes, anticipated objections, and competitive differentiators. Provide badges or certifications tied to update mastery to incentivize participation and track progress. By weaving content into ongoing learning journeys, you reinforce knowledge retention and create a culture where updates are not only received but actively practiced in conversations with customers.
Invest in a toolkit that makes training accessible anywhere, anytime. Build a searchable archive with tagging by problem-solution pairs, so sellers can quickly locate the exact talking points for a given objection. Include interactive calculators, pricing simulators, and trial data snapshots that illustrate value in real terms. Encourage regional champions to co-host refresher sessions, capturing practical insights for the broader network. Measuring engagement metrics—time spent in modules, completion rates, and scenario success rates—helps identify gaps and tailor upcoming content to address them. With consistent, practical training, partners translate updates into tangible sales performance.

Cadence that mirrors lifecycles yields cohesive partner experiences.
Feedback loops are essential for continuous improvement. Establish a formal channel for resellers to rate updates on clarity, usefulness, and impact on selling conversations. Use short, structured surveys after major releases and quarterly sentiment reviews to capture qualitative input. Pair this with quarterly business reviews where leaders discuss update effectiveness alongside pipeline health and quota attainment. Close the loop by publicly acknowledging what worked and what didn’t, and by prioritizing next steps that address the most significant gaps. Transparent, data-informed adjustments reinforce trust and demonstrate that partner input directly shapes future content.
Align cadence with product and pricing lifecycles to avoid misalignment risks. Coordinate release calendars so that product launches, price changes, and incentive programs are introduced in concert rather than in isolation. Build a staging process that previews changes to select partner segments before full deployment, allowing time to craft tailored messages and battle cards for each audience. Maintain a versioning system that clearly labels major, minor, and contextual updates. Communicate maintenance windows for critical changes and ensure customers see consistent experiences across all reseller channels. This approach minimizes confusion and sustains confidence among partners.
Governance and accountability drive durable outcomes. Assign a leadership sponsor responsible for the cadence, with quarterly reviews measuring adoption, impact on win rates, and partner feedback scores. Publish a concise, publicly accessible update scoreboard so stakeholders can see progress and bottlenecks at a glance. Align incentives with cadence goals, offering recognition for teams that accelerate content adoption or improve pitch effectiveness. Ensure compliance with branding and messaging guidelines so every asset maintains a uniform, professional appearance. A disciplined governance framework creates predictability, which in turn accelerates partner credibility and customer trust.
Finally, design for evolution. The SaaS market shifts rapidly, and the update cadence must adapt without losing its rhythm. Build a roadmap that accommodates emerging product categories, pricing innovations, and new sales motions while preserving core rhythms. Regularly reassess channel readiness, tooling efficiency, and resell partner needs, adjusting the cadence as necessary. Document lessons learned from each cycle to avoid repeating missteps and to compound gains over time. By embracing continuous improvement, your partner ecosystem stays ahead of competitors, sustains momentum, and delivers measurable, durable value to customers and stakeholders alike.
